Got a message on LinkedIn to see if there was interest. Once I responded Sarah set me up with a phone screen after that I got an actual interview, Did not take long to send an offer either,
I had a really positive experience with the interview process. A recruiter reached out to me about a day after I made my resume public on Indeed. I had a zoom meeting with her where she asked me standard interview questions and about my sales background. She was able to schedule a same day interview with a hiring manager. I felt I had a really good connection with that particular manager and after my interview I was sent an offer for the position.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Tell me about a time you experienced objection
How can you apply your previous experience in this role

Leasing Consultant applicants have rated the interview process at Essex Property Trust with 2.5 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 61% positive. To compare, the company-average is 52%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Leasing Consultant roles take an average of 17 days to get hired, when considering 18 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Essex Property Trust overall takes an average of 15 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Essex Property Trust as a Leasing Consultant according to 18 Glassdoor interviews include:
One on one interview: 23%
Background check: 21%
Drug test: 19%
Phone interview: 13%
Skills test: 11%
Personality test: 4%
Group panel interview: 4%
Presentation: 2%
IQ intelligence test: 2%
Other: 2%
